Trace Elements in Environmental History Proceedings of the Symposium held from June 24th to 26th, 1987, at Göttingen

This book contains the contributions to an European symposium on "Trace Elements in Environmental History", held from June 24th to 26th at GCittingen, FRG. The confe­ rence was organised by the Institute of Anthropology of the Georg August-University in GCittingen. At first glance, it migh...
